Canada flight cancelled after child refuses to wear seat belt

✦AI Summary
A Porter Airlines flight from Victoria to Toronto was cancelled after a child refused to wear a seat belt, forcing the plane to return to the terminal. The incident has sparked a public debate regarding airline safety protocols and parental responsibility.
